本文目录导读:
图片来源于网络,如有侵权联系删除
随着互联网、物联网、大数据等技术的飞速发展,数据量呈爆炸式增长,传统的存储方式已经无法满足大数据存储的需求,分布式存储作为一种新兴的存储技术,以其高可靠性、高可用性和高扩展性等特点,成为大数据存储领域的主流选择,本文将详细介绍大数据分布式存储的常用技术及其应用前景。
大数据分布式存储常用技术
1、分布式文件系统
分布式文件系统是大数据分布式存储的核心技术之一,它将数据分散存储在多个节点上,实现了数据的冗余存储和负载均衡,常见的分布式文件系统有:
(1)Hadoop Distributed File System(HDFS):HDFS是Apache Hadoop项目的一部分,主要用于存储大量数据,它采用主从架构,具有高可靠性、高吞吐量和高扩展性等特点。
(2)GFS(Google File System):GFS是Google开发的一种分布式文件系统,具有高可靠性、高吞吐量和低延迟等特点,它被广泛应用于Google的搜索引擎、地图服务等项目中。
(3)Ceph:Ceph是一种开源的分布式存储系统,具有高可靠性、高可用性和高扩展性等特点,它支持多种存储类型,如对象存储、块存储和文件存储。
2、分布式数据库
分布式数据库是大数据分布式存储的另一种核心技术,它将数据分散存储在多个节点上,实现了数据的分布式处理和负载均衡,常见的分布式数据库有:
(1)HBase:HBase是Apache Hadoop项目的一部分,基于HDFS存储,主要用于存储非结构化和半结构化数据,它具有高可靠性、高吞吐量和高可扩展性等特点。
图片来源于网络,如有侵权联系删除
(2)Cassandra:Cassandra是一种开源的分布式数据库,具有高可靠性、高可用性和高扩展性等特点,它支持无模式设计,适用于处理大量数据。
(3)MongoDB:MongoDB是一种开源的分布式文档数据库,具有高可靠性、高可用性和高扩展性等特点,它支持多种数据模型,如文档、键值对和列族。
3、分布式缓存
分布式缓存是大数据分布式存储的一种补充技术,它将热点数据缓存到内存中,提高了数据访问速度,常见的分布式缓存有:
(1)Memcached:Memcached是一种高性能的分布式缓存系统,具有高性能、高可用性和高扩展性等特点。
(2)Redis:Redis是一种开源的内存数据结构存储系统,具有高性能、高可用性和高扩展性等特点,它支持多种数据结构,如字符串、列表、集合、有序集合等。
大数据分布式存储应用前景
1、云计算
随着云计算的快速发展,大数据分布式存储技术将成为云计算基础设施的重要组成部分,通过分布式存储,云计算平台可以提供更加可靠、高效和可扩展的数据存储服务。
2、物联网
图片来源于网络,如有侵权联系删除
物联网(IoT)的发展需要大量的数据存储和处理能力,分布式存储技术可以帮助物联网平台实现海量数据的存储、分析和处理,为物联网应用提供有力支持。
3、人工智能
人工智能技术的发展离不开大数据和分布式存储,分布式存储技术可以支持大规模数据的存储和处理,为人工智能算法提供数据基础。
4、金融行业
金融行业对数据的安全性和可靠性要求极高,分布式存储技术可以帮助金融机构实现海量交易数据的存储、备份和恢复,提高金融系统的稳定性和安全性。
大数据分布式存储技术作为大数据时代的重要基础设施,具有广泛的应用前景,随着技术的不断发展和完善,分布式存储将在云计算、物联网、人工智能和金融等领域发挥越来越重要的作用。
标签: #大数据分布式存储
评论列表